From 6441a27cc69dc95d74f64f2869eb54181b10cbec Mon Sep 17 00:00:00 2001 From: wangzhengquan <wangzhengquan85@126.com> Date: 星期二, 28 七月 2020 10:13:10 +0800 Subject: [PATCH] commit --- test_socket/dgram_mod_bus.c | 9 +++++++-- 1 files changed, 7 insertions(+), 2 deletions(-) diff --git a/test_socket/dgram_mod_bus.c b/test_socket/dgram_mod_bus.c index 1c6268d..b016cbc 100644 --- a/test_socket/dgram_mod_bus.c +++ b/test_socket/dgram_mod_bus.c @@ -3,10 +3,15 @@ #include "usg_common.h" #include "mm.h" - +void * server_socket; +void sigint_handler(int sig) { + dgram_mod_close_socket(server_socket); + exit(0); +} void server(int port, bool restart) { - void * server_socket = dgram_mod_open_socket(); + // signal(SIGINT, sigint_handler); + server_socket = dgram_mod_open_socket(); if(restart) { dgram_mod_force_bind(server_socket, port); -- Gitblit v1.8.0